The AQA Spanish 90 Word Paper 4 Writing Mat is a comprehensive tool designed to help students excel in their Spanish writing exams. This mat outlines the key ingredients necessary for achieving high scores, ranging from 5 to 8 points.
For a score of 5, students should focus on covering all bullet points of the task, including at least two opinions with reasons, and using past, present, and future tenses. The mat emphasizes the importance of talking about oneself and at least one other person, using connectives, adjectives, adverbs, and intensifiers.
Highlight: To achieve a score of 8, students should incorporate more advanced elements such as comparatives, the conditional tense, and idioms.
The mat provides an extensive list of useful vocabulary, including:
Vocabulary: Intensifiers (e.g., "demasiado", "la mayoría"), adverbs (e.g., "normalmente", "generalmente"), and conditional phrases (e.g., "Me gustaría", "Sería").
It also offers a variety of opinion expressions and adjectives to enrich writing:
Example: "Me gusta/n mucho" (I like a lot), "Odio" (I hate), "bueno/a" (good), "horrible" (horrible).
The mat includes a marking scheme breakdown, emphasizing the importance of covering all aspects of the task, providing opinions, and using a variety of appropriate vocabulary. It also stresses the need for complexity, three time frames, and a clear message that fits the task.
Definition: Connectives are words or phrases that link ideas in writing. The mat provides a comprehensive list of connectives such as "pero" (but), "cuando" (when), and "porque" (because).
Lastly, the mat offers useful phrases for giving reasons for opinions and some idiomatic expressions to elevate the writing quality.
Quote: "Es una lástima que" (It's a shame that) and "Vale la pena" (It's worth it) are examples of idiomatic expressions provided.
